The Core Principle of Lottery Draws
At the heart of every lottery is randomness. For a lottery to be fair, every ticket or number must have an equal chance of being selected. This principle ensures that no player has an advantage and that the game operates with integrity. Randomness can be achieved in several ways, depending on the lottery’s structure and regulations. Some use physical machines with numbered balls, while others rely on advanced computer algorithms designed to eliminate patterns and predictability.
Physical Lottery Draws: Traditional Methods
In many parts of the world, lottery draws still use physical methods. Machines filled with numbered balls are commonly seen in televised draws. These machines are designed with strict engineering standards to ensure unbiased results. The balls are identical in weight, size, and material, so none is easier to draw than another. Independent auditors and regulatory bodies usually oversee the process to confirm that everything runs fairly.
This traditional approach, still used in many state-run lotteries, adds a sense of transparency because the process is visible. Players can watch the balls being mixed and drawn, reinforcing trust in the randomness of the outcome.

Role of Regulatory Authorities
Transparency in lotteries does not rely solely on the technology or machines used. Regulatory authorities play a crucial role in overseeing and verifying the entire process. Independent observers, auditors, and gaming commissions ensure that the draw process is fair, documented, and compliant with legal standards. Without this oversight, even the most advanced systems could be subject to doubts.
In many jurisdictions, strict regulations dictate how draws must be conducted, how machines are maintained, and how often RNGs must be tested. These measures help ensure the integrity of lottery systems and maintain player confidence.
Preventing Fraud and Manipulation
The fairness of a lottery is directly tied to its reputation. To prevent fraud, multiple security measures are implemented. In physical draws, equipment is regularly tested and sealed before use. For computerized draws, encrypted systems, secure servers, and independent monitoring are applied. Additionally, most reputable lotteries publish their draw results openly, allowing players to cross-check them with multiple sources.
